Job Summary

Your Career

We're seeking innovators - engineers who seek to design new products, designing state-of-the-art products that do not exist today. These engineers love to code with a drive to build global products and bring new ideas to develop security disciplines to solve real-world problems. We are looking for leaders who take ownership of their areas of focus and who are driven to pursue problems at every level. Collaboration is at the heart of our culture and we need engineers who can communicate at a high level and work well with multi-functional teams towards achieving a common goal.

As a member of Layer-7 Application Security group, you will be responsible for designing and developing security features on the next-generation firewall platform integrating with our security services cloud. You will work with product management on user requirements, apply your knowledge to functional design, utilize your programming skills for efficient and robust implementation, and interact with quality assurance and field support teams throughout the entire software development cycle.

Your Impact

  • You will be expected to participate in all phases of the product development cycle, from definition, design, through implementation and test
  • Develop functional specifications, assess task requirements and scheduling, and participate in development, debug and support
  • Candidate should also have hands-on experience with networking or network security technologies and C language development in a Unix/Linux environment
  • Suggest and implement improvements to the development process
  • Be able to clearly communicate goals and desired outcomes to internal project teams
  • Interview, mentor and coach new team members

Qualifications

Your Experience
  • Proficient in C and familiar with Unix/Linux development environment
  • Working knowledge of TCP/IP internals and L7 protocols
  • Working knowledge of common data structures and algorithms
  • Verbal and written communication skills to work with cross-functional groups
  • Team player with a can-do attitude in a dynamic working environment

Preferred Qualifications

  • Advance level of software development experience
  • Graduate degree (MS or PhD) in Computer Science or similar technical discipline
  • Knowledge of multi-core / multi-process / multi-threaded programming
  • Experience with network packet processing software development, 7 - 10 years
  • Experience with application layer protocols such as HTTP, SIP, H.323, DNS, etc.
  • Experience with and interest to learn other programming languages
  • Experience with large-scale and/or high-performance software design and development
  • Experience with deep packet inspection engine
  • Experience with GoLang
